It turns out I didn't test this properly. The warning is only triggered when I close and open the lid, not when I run 'snooze' to suspend and hit Return to resume, as I did for my so-called testing of 2.6.29-rc4.
Whatever is triggering the warning is still present in 2.6.29-rc5.
